Tshilemalema Mukenge. Culture and Customs of the Congo. Westport, Conn.: Greenwood Press, 2002. xx + 204 pp. Photographs. Glossary. Bibliography. Index. $45.00. Cloth.
The third installment in the Greenwood Culture and Customs of Africa series, Tshilemalema Mukenge's book may seem at first glance a fact-oriented survey of one of Africa's richest and most complex countries. But as one sifts through the chapters, the book indeed delivers on its promise to "capture the elements of continuity and change in culture and customs" (viii). It is divided into eight chapters, including an introduction that provides some solid background information. From religion to architecture, music and marriage, Mukenge never loses sight of Congo's diversity through examples drawn from various regional groups.
